Emerson council starts planning internship program with high school; department heads to explore placements

Emerson governing body · December 4, 2024

Summary

Council members supported exploring an internship for Emerson Junior-Senior High School students; borough staff will ask department heads about hosting students (likely Fridays, about noon–3 p.m.) and follow up after the department-head meeting.

The governing body discussed a proposed internship program for Emerson Junior‑Senior High School students during new business on Dec. 3. Chair introduced the topic and asked Mr. Hermanson to summarize. Mr. Hermanson said the school and Chamber of Commerce asked the borough to distribute a letter to department heads to see whether seniors could intern with borough departments, with a likely schedule of Fridays between about 12:00 p.m. and 3:00 p.m.

Council members signaled general support. Mr. Hermanson said department heads will review the request at their next meeting and the borough will coordinate logistics, such as whether students would take college classes or participate in internships, and how to handle lunch and schedules. The council did not take formal action or approve a program budget during the meeting; staff will report back with details after consulting department heads and the school.

Why it matters: the program could provide work experience to high-school seniors and give borough departments occasional student support. The initiative is in an exploratory stage; the council directed staff to follow up rather than adopting a formal policy at this meeting.
